Detailed Solution
Parathyroid hormone is hyper calcemic while calcitonin is hypocalcemic and thus are antagonistic in function.Both melatonin and thymosin have a role in defense (immune response).Thyroxine(T4) and triiodothyronine (T3) maintain BMR.Both ADH and aldosterone decrease the blood pressure.
